Which two groups were able to take over the city of rome in the late 300s and early 400s AD?
sergejj [24]

For a time some Germanic peoples were allowed to live peacefully within the Roman Empire. Many of them fought in the Roman army, and some became military leaders. Then, during the late A.D. 300s and the A.D. 400s, the Germanic tribes began entering Roman territory in large numbers. Their own lands were being taken over by a people from central Asia called the Huns.


By attacking the Germanic tribes, the Huns caused one of the largest migrations of people in world history. The migration of the Germanic peoples into the Western Roman Empire was more than just a movement of people, however. Some historians have called it "the migration of nations." Others consider it a time of invasion.

How did the Bourbon Triumvirate hurt Georgia?
Assoli18 [71]

The Bourbon Triumvirate hurted Georgia because they did not:

  • really help the poor
  • improve education
  • improve lives of the convicts

<h3>Who were Bourbon Triumvirate?</h3>

The Bourbon Triumvirate referred to Joseph Brown, John Gordon and Alfred Colquitt; who were group of wealthy men that led the Georgia Democrats and tried to help the wealthy, white citizens of Georgia during the New South.

Despite that the Bourbon Triumvirate wanted the state of Georgia to become self-sufficient, they were not too successful at it.
